Circus Dreams

This always entertaining and often moving documentary tells the story of a dynamic group of 12- to 18-year-olds performing in Cirkus Smirkus, which is the country’s only traveling youth circus. The movie provides an intimate look at the circus world, revealing the intense work ethic, cooperative culture, and magically mobile nature of circus life. By delving into the young performers’ obsession with these ancient arts, the documentary also explores, in a revealing and authentic way, how it feels to be an American teenager today.
